Events are entering a new era, and social media is becoming an increasingly important and visible element in the transformation of events.  As events evolve away from fixed, didactic experiences to more collaborative, fluid, and participatory experiences, social media has become increasingly integral to the event experience.

As this white paper demonstrates, particularly through key case studies, evidence is mounting that social media is having a significant impact on a whole range of event functions.  In fact, social media has become central to the success of a growing number of events, and entire events have been developed around social media.

The experts interviewed for this white paper lend credence to the notion that social media is truly transforming events into more dynamic, enduring, and rewarding experiences for attendees, event producers, speakers, and exhibitors alike.  But they also stress the importance of judiciously applying social media in events to achieve the right impact, and caution against frittering away social media applications in events with haphazard implementation and underdeveloped strategies.

This white paper is designed to offer a broader perspective on the role of social media in events, and highlight key strategies for maximizing the impact of social media in events.
